Форум программистов, компьютерный форум, киберфорум
Электроника и радиотехника
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.65/103: Рейтинг темы: голосов - 103, средняя оценка - 4.65
Otusk

плата контроллера PIC32 с TFT, USB, ethernet и проч.

05.01.2013, 01:25. Показов 19182. Ответов 16
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Продолжая тему форума <a ctoss="postlink-local" href="http://forum.iosyitistromyss.ru/viewtopys.php?f=16&t=13411">viewtopys.ph p?f=16&t=13411[/URL] выкладываю 2 версию платы контроллера,
которая будет изготавливаться после новогодних каникул.

Прошу форумчан высказать, возможно, какие-то замечания или пожелания, по улучшению платы, уменьшению ее себестоимости,
улучшению потребительских качеств. Вообщем на общее обсуждение.


./styles/iosyitistromyss/imageset/icon_topys_attach.gif" width="14" height="18
[243.52 Кб]

IT_Exp
Эксперт
34794 / 4073 / 2104
Регистрация: 17.06.2006
Сообщений: 32,602
Блог
05.01.2013, 01:25
Ответы с готовыми решениями:

Плата контроллера PIC32 c TFT экраном и USB
Сделал макетную плату для контроллера PIC32MX795F512L с интерфейсом под экран с контроллером SSD1289, тачскрин ADS7843, на борту так же...

Дисплей TFT 160x128 RGB и плата Arduino Mega 2560 + WiFi ESP8266 (micro usb)
Здравствуйте. Пользуясь случаем задам в этой теме вопрос. Есть дисплей TFT 160x128 RGB и плата Arduino Mega 2560 + WiFi ESP8266 (micro...

Отладочная плата PIC32
Отладочная плата PIC32 на базе PIC32MX440F256H Характеристики: 1) 4 варианта питания - от шины USB, от внешнего 5В адаптера, от...

16
Otusk
12.01.2013, 11:48
Выкладываю последнюю редакцию схемы и платы. Из изменений: разъем LAN заменен на более дешевый/доступный, добавлен резонатор 32,768кГц для возможности использовать RTCC контролллера, изменен тип резонаторов на более дешевый/доступный, внешнее прерывание отобрано у тачскрина и отдано модулю MI-WI.
Плата - коммерческий проект и ее можно будет купить. Для тех для тех кто захочет повторить (сделать ее сам): схема и исходные коды будут в открытом доступе и выложены на сайте.
Для тех кто захочет приобрести - мы открыли предзаказ [236.54 Кб]
0 / 0 / 0
Регистрация: 03.05.2012
Сообщений: 141
13.01.2013, 06:59
Хотелось бы узнать, в каком CADе так документация(схема) выводится?
0
Otusk
13.01.2013, 08:45
Цитата Сообщение от Xomuk
Хотелось бы узнать, в каком CADе так документация(схема) выводится?
Все сделано в PCAD-2004
Otusk
15.01.2013, 23:39
Дополнительные акссесуары для платы на www.cedarlab.ru
Otusk
17.01.2013, 01:26
Ответ на вопрос о габаритах платы дублирую в теме.


./styles/iosyitistromyss/imageset/icon_topys_attach.gif" width="14" height="18
[175.31 Кб]
Otusk
21.01.2013, 16:52
Платы тестовой партии пришли, начинаем сборку. Выкладываю фото плат.

omx
21.01.2013, 17:49
Вот обратил внимание на разводку ethernet на вашей плате. Есть несколько соображений:
1. Расстояние от PHY до трансформатора рекомендуют от 1 до 4 дюймов
Troubleshooting IEEE Conformance Test Failures
EVB8720 Ethernet PHY Evaluation Board

http://www.smsc.som/cache/thumbnail_w520_mh_q90_90dc28d2bc2dec0b1e 51b3bbb6bc1c7b.jpg
Сам делал такую ошибку. Как результат: на малых длинах кабеля всё работало, а на больших - нет.
3. Пару TXN/TXP можно было провести чуть лучше. Дорожку к 3 пину разъёма можно было вести не между 2 и 4 пинами, а между 1 и 2.
Otusk
22.01.2013, 08:59
Спасибо... Добавлю для тех кто, возможно, будет делать плату сам: землю под разъемом LAN правильней делать полигоном с последующим соединением с основным земляным полигоном 0 резистором.
Otusk
22.01.2013, 23:10
Плата собрана начинаем проверку...



Otusk
25.01.2013, 23:11
1. В схеме электрической ошибка: неправильная распайка трансформатора TR1 (LU1T516-43LF). Должно быть так: пин 2 - "T+", пин 3 - "TСТ".

Лечение: доработка платы... . Пришлось заменить м/с LAN8720. После чего Ethernet заработал. Учесть в серийной партии.

2. Разъем USB слишком удален от края платы. Первая попытка подключения кабеля показала, что разъем на кабеле пластиковой изоляцией упирается в край платы и не позволяет надежно его зафиксировать. Как выяснилось, кабели конструктивно отличаются, остальные два, имеющиеся в наличии, подключились без проблем.

Лечение:
Так как плата разрабатывается с возможностью установки в открытую платформу, то расположение USB разъема на плате менятся не будет.

3. При попытке установки в плату платы TFT экрана выяснилось, что держатель батареи верхним выводом упирается в слот для SD карты.

Лечение: Подогнуть вывод или использовать батарейку с выводами для пайки в плату. Учесть в серийной партии.

4. Тока от USB разъема не хватает для работы платы совместно с платой экрана, уже сказывается появление преобразователя развязки RS-485 c его током потребления.

5. Работа экрана, тачскрина и сд проверена, нареканий нет.

6. Код загрузчика от Microchip адаптирован для платы, загрузка тестовой программы по интерфейсам USB/Ethernet/RS232/RS485 проверена, нареканий нет. Выкладываю проекты для загрузчика и простого приложения(включение светодиодов) выкладываю на сайте.
Сайт проекта www.cedarlab.ru
0 / 0 / 0
Регистрация: 30.12.2012
Сообщений: 222
25.01.2013, 23:59
Не хватает чего-нибудь типа парочки 4-20/0-20 мА для аналоговых сигналов.
0
0 / 0 / 0
Регистрация: 23.03.2012
Сообщений: 1,017
27.01.2013, 00:25
А я бы корпуса мелких кварцев на землю припаял...
0
Otusk
10.02.2013, 20:01
Пришли исправленные платы, начинаем собирать
Otusk
02.03.2013, 00:13
Видео работы платы http://www.youtube.som/watch?feature=pl ... 9FpAg5KRMQ
0 / 0 / 0
Регистрация: 10.03.2012
Сообщений: 1,110
02.03.2013, 01:08
очень красиво :) Молодец!
0
Otusk
03.04.2013, 09:54
На сайте заработал нигазин http://cedarlab.ru/store.html.
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
BasicMan
Эксперт
29316 / 5623 / 2384
Регистрация: 17.02.2009
Сообщений: 30,364
Блог
03.04.2013, 09:54
Помогаю со студенческими работами здесь

Выбор MCU/MPU (TFT, Ethernet)
Приветствую! Помогите подобрать МК или МП для таких вот требований: 1. Поддержка Ethernet 2. Работа с TFT, разрешение не ниже...

Ethernet MAC контроллера Atmel
Добрый день! Использую ATSAM3x8e совместно с трансивером DP83848i. Автосогласование проходит на ура. Потом начинается прием пакета в...

Драйвер для Ethernet контроллера на MacBook
Здравствуйте!.. Помогите разобраться, пожалуйста... Не могу найти драйвер для Ethernet-контроллера на MacBook под Windows 7. Диспетчер...

Старт изучения контроллера ethernet (W5100)
Требуется ответ от специалистов, имевших дело с контроллером Wyznet W5100. Для реализации задуманного проекта требуется наличие...

Горят USB и порты мыши и клавиатуры, как определить работоспособность USB-контроллера?
Всем привет! Горят USB-порты и порты мыши и клавиатуры, как определить работоспособность USB-контроллера? Системная плата ASRock N68C-S...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
17
Ответ Создать тему
Новые блоги и статьи
Новый ноутбук
volvo 07.12.2025
Всем привет. По скидке в "черную пятницу" взял себе новый ноутбук Lenovo ThinkBook 16 G7 на Амазоне: Ryzen 5 7533HS 64 Gb DDR5 1Tb NVMe 16" Full HD Display Win11 Pro
Музыка, написанная Искусственным Интеллектом
volvo 04.12.2025
Всем привет. Некоторое время назад меня заинтересовало, что уже умеет ИИ в плане написания музыки для песен, и, собственно, исполнения этих самых песен. Стихов у нас много, уже вышли 4 книги, еще 3. . .
От async/await к виртуальным потокам в Python
IndentationError 23.11.2025
Армин Ронахер поставил под сомнение async/ await. Создатель Flask заявляет: цветные функции - провал, виртуальные потоки - решение. Не threading-динозавры, а новое поколение лёгких потоков. Откат?. . .
Поиск "дружественных имён" СОМ портов
Argus19 22.11.2025
Поиск "дружественных имён" СОМ портов На странице: https:/ / norseev. ru/ 2018/ 01/ 04/ comportlist_windows/ нашёл схожую тему. Там приведён код на С++, который показывает только имена СОМ портов, типа,. . .
Сколько Государство потратило денег на меня, обеспечивая инсулином.
Programma_Boinc 20.11.2025
Сколько Государство потратило денег на меня, обеспечивая инсулином. Вот решила сделать интересный приблизительный подсчет, сколько государство потратило на меня денег на покупку инсулинов. . . .
Ломающие изменения в C#.NStar Alpha
Etyuhibosecyu 20.11.2025
Уже можно не только тестировать, но и пользоваться C#. NStar - писать оконные приложения, содержащие надписи, кнопки, текстовые поля и даже изображения, например, моя игра "Три в ряд" написана на этом. . .
Мысли в слух
kumehtar 18.11.2025
Кстати, совсем недавно имел разговор на тему медитаций с людьми. И обнаружил, что они вообще не понимают что такое медитация и зачем она нужна. Самые базовые вещи. Для них это - когда просто люди. . .
Создание Single Page Application на фреймах
krapotkin 16.11.2025
Статья исключительно для начинающих. Подходы оригинальностью не блещут. В век Веб все очень привыкли к дизайну Single-Page-Application . Быстренько разберем подход "на фреймах". Мы делаем одну. . .
Фото: Daniel Greenwood
kumehtar 13.11.2025
Расскажи мне о Мире, бродяга
kumehtar 12.11.2025
— Расскажи мне о Мире, бродяга, Ты же видел моря и метели. Как сменялись короны и стяги, Как эпохи стрелою летели. - Этот мир — это крылья и горы, Снег и пламя, любовь и тревоги, И бескрайние.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2025, CyberForum.ru